Day 32 Tebbetts MO to Franklin MO

This is my last full day on the KATY Trail. While it can become monotonous at times, especially when you’re riding alone, I try to appreciate it for what it is- a long trail without the worry of cars or nasty hills. I’m trying to live in the present as I know starting tomorrow I may have a radically different experience. It’s been kind of nice not having to worry about my blinky being charged. Also, it’s pretty difficult to get lost!

Peter dropped me off at the Tebbetts trail head and I immediately realized that I had left my helmet in the trailer. Peter went to retrieve it while I rode to the North Jefferson trailhead 12 miles away. Peter returned with the helmet but to the Jefferson spur a mile away. I just biked there, got the helmet, got Henry’s greeting (it doesn’t matter if you’ve been gone 5 minutes or 5 years), and returned to the trail, cranium now protected. 
I’m seeing a lot of Queen Anne’s Lace now and just noticed the red in the center. Supposedly this is because the Queen pricked her finger while making lace.

I kept straining my neck to find the pictographs on the bluffs before Rocheport but never saw any. I did see what I think was a storage place for explosives used in constructing the railroad. And I saw a few caves. 

Heart 3 Comment 0
Heart 4 Comment 0
Heart 0 Comment 0

I was hoping to visit the bike shop/cafe in Rocheport but it closed at 4:00. 5 minutes too late. I really liked the tunnel west of The town. The east entry is rock then the rest of it is cut stone on the bottom with brick above.
